Description: English: Macaranga peltata ((syn. M. roxburghii, M. tomentosa, Tanarius peltatus, Mappa peltata, Osyris peltata)- macaranga, narrow woolly-stipuled lotus croton, Roxburgh's lotus-croton, batla chamdrike, chamdakala, upplige, chamdivado, chandado, chandole, chandava, keanda, vatti-k-kanni, boddi, Chandada • Hindi: Chand Kal • Marathi: Chanda, Chandwar • Tamil: Vattakanni • Malayalam: Thodukanni, Uppila, Vatta • Telugu: Boddi • Kannada: Vattathamarai, Chanda kala • Oriya: Piania • Konkani: Kondatamara- in Goa, India.
